Thanks viprklr. Can I ask another question...

What sort of dimensions do you have in your garage for this? I visited the site, and checked out the sizing recommendations, but I would like to understand what people are really installing into. I am hoping to avoid expensive roof/truss mods to get more height...but I guess it all depends what you want to put under the vehicle.

Bend Pak lift

I myself have a 3 car garage as follows:
2 car has 18' x 7' opening
1 car has 8' x 7' opening
Garage height is 10'1" floor to ceiling. I did however go with the narrow lift. Bend pak offers two versions (wide & narrow). As I recall, their was about 15" difference.
